West Ham United 3-1 Newcastle United
West Ham United's David di Michele hit a brace to help see off Newcastle United 3-1 at Upton Park.



It was the perfect start for Gianfranco Zola who began his reign as West Ham manager in style.

The former Chelsea star officially took up his duties on Monday - and the Hammers responded to record a third home successive win.

11038
Di Michele, on a season loan from Torino, set them on their way with a deflected effort after just eight minutes and then added another before half-time.

Matthew Etherington made it 3-0 before England striker Michael Owen salvaged a consolation for the visitors.

Sort this Toon mess out, Ashley

MICHAEL OWEN has told Newcastle owner Mike Ashley: Sort out the mess — now!

The Toon striker wants Kevin Keegan’s successor appointed urgently to stop the rot.

Newcastle, 19th in the Premier League, host rock-bottom Tottenham in the Carling Cup tonight, with their lowest crowd for almost 17 years expected — just 20,000.

Owen said: “The sooner we get out of this situation the better, so we can concentrate again on football.

"There is lots of speculation and it unsettles fans and players alike.

“I think you always respond best when you’ve a manager in place, a focal point you answer to, perform for and try to impress. We’ve not got that at the minute.

“Even our caretaker manager Chris Hughton, who has done a fantastic job and steadied the ship, says the sooner we can get it sorted the better.

“Everyone knows that, the owner knows that and I’m sure he’s working as hard as he can to bring some stability to the club.

“It’s not just the managerial thing, it’s everything surrounding it — who the owner is going to be, whether Mike Ashley is going to continue or sell to someone else, whether he’s going to appoint a manager before that happens or after. Nobody knows.

“What we do know is it would be nice to have a stable ship, as we did at the start of the campaign when we were all really excited about this season.

“We all liked Kevin Keegan and were sad to see him go. But we have to snap out of the doom and gloom to try to get some confidence and results.

“You almost become immune to these happenings in football nowadays. I had three managers in the space of a few months at Real Madrid.

“It’s unfortunate but that’s the way it goes.”

Owen called on the fans to throw their support behind the team whatever their feelings towards the men at the top.

He declared: “It is always important to have them backing you and it will be great if they are behind us against Spurs.It’s difficult but we are all in this together.”

Owen’s worries may be solved if the Nigerian consortium pledging to bid for the club can get round the table with Ashley.

As SunSport revealed yesterday, they have promised to bring back Keegan and provide him with £75m for new players. undefined

Premier League - Martins brace lifts Newcastle

Obafemi Martins scored the goals as Newcastle lifted themselves out of the relegation zone with a 2-0 home victory over high-flying Aston Villa.

Martins scored two second-half goals as Newcastle became the third side in as many days to win from the bottom of the Premier League table, following the achievements of Tottenham and Bolton.

Aston Villa had much the better of the first half but could not get going after the break as they missed the opportunity to break into the top three.

Villa certainly had the two best chances of a first half that started brightly but became scrappy and full of stoppages as it went on.

By the time Newcastle's best moment came when centre-back Steven Taylor was just inches away from turning home an inviting cross from the right from Habib Beye four minutes before the break, Villa had already hit the post and spurned two fine chances.

First, Villa defender Martin Laursen flicked the outside of the post with a towering header from a corner to come within inches of his fifth goal of the campaign, before an unmarked Gabby Agbonlahor completely mis-cued eight yards out after James Milner rolled the ball across to him.

Ashley Young then brought a 35th-minute save out of Shay Given - making his 450th appearances for the club - when he beat his man and earned some space 10 yards out with a body swerve before driving straight at the face of the Toon keeper.

Villa - out after the break a good couple of minutes earlier than the home side - began the second half like a side desperate to break the deadlock, but it was Newcastle who brought the match to life.

Joey Barton, lucky to escape a first-half booking when he petulantly flicked out a hand into the face of Agbonlahor in an off-the-ball incident, was shown a yellow card for a studs-up challenge in midfield as the game threatened to boil over.

And just before the hour, the home side had the lead when Martins held up Barton's pass on the edge of the box and, afforded some space to turn by Laursen, moved the ball onto his left foot before firing a low shot inside the near post from 20 yards, just out of the reach of diving Villa keeper Brad Freidel.

The goal gave the home side and their fans the confidence and belief to push for a game-clinching second, which almost came just seven minutes later when Nicky Butt's 25-yard free-kick beat Freidel but crashed against the post.

Villa boss Martin O'Neill used the break in play to replace Nicky Shorey with midfielder Steve Sidwell, moving Nigel Reo-Coker to makeshift right-back - but the move backfired with eight minutes remaining.

Jonas Gutiérrez surged into the box from the left wing, easily rounding Reo-Coker in the process, before firing the ball across the face of goal for Martins to thump it into the net from a yard out and secure a hugely-important victory for his side.
